GRAND CHUTE — A Florida teen was killed and two others injured when a van crashed into a building Monday while attempting to park in Grand Chute.

According to a news release from the Grand Chute Police Department, police and fire emergency responders were called out at 3:52 p.m. Monday to a report of a vehicle striking a building in the 2900 block of W. College Ave. in Grand Chute, where multiple injuries were reported.

Investigators say a passenger van drove into the building while attempting to park, striking several people inside.

An 18-year-old from Parrish, Florida, was transported by ambulance to a local hospital, where they were pronounced deceased.

Two additional people were also transported by ambulance to local hospitals for treatment of non-life-threatening injuries.

The news release did not clarify if the person killed or the people injured were inside the building or inside the van.

The Grand Chute Police Department was assisted on scene by the Wisconsin State Patrol, Outagamie County Sheriff’s Office, Gold Cross Ambulance, and the Fox Cities Victim Crisis Response Team.
